. One jar contains 43 grape Skittles, 23 orange, 15 yellow, 18 cherry, and 12 lime. Another jar contains 20 grape, 22 orange, 18

yellow, 21 cherry and 19 lime. You close your eyes and grab one Skittle from each jar. What is the probability both are grape? What is the probability neither are grape?
Mathematics
1 answer:
amm18124 years ago
8 0

Answer:

see below

Step-by-step explanation:

Jar 1 :

43 grape Skittles, 23 orange, 15 yellow, 18 cherry, and 12 lime = 111

P ( grape ) = 43/111

Jar 2 :

20 grape, 22 orange, 18 yellow, 21 cherry and 19 lime = 100

P ( grape ) = 20/100 = 1/5

P(grape, grape ) = 43/111 *1/5 = 43/555

Jar 1 :

43 grape Skittles, 23 orange, 15 yellow, 18 cherry, and 12 lime = 111

P ( not grape grape ) =68/111

Jar 2 :

20 grape, 22 orange, 18 yellow, 21 cherry and 19 lime = 100

P ( grape ) = 80/100 = 4/5

P(grape, grape ) =68/111 *4/5 =272/555

If 4SINB=3SIN(2A+B) :<br> Prove that:7COT(A+B)=COTA
pickupchik [31]

Answer:

Step-by-step explanation:

Given the expression 4sinB = 3sin(2A+B), we are to show that the expression 7cot(A+B) = cotA

Starting with the expression

4sinB= 3sin(2A+B)

Let us re write angle B = (A + B) - A

and 2A + B = (A + B) + A

Substituting the derived expression back into the original expression ww will have;

4Sin{(A + B) - A } = 3Sin{(A + B)+ A}

From trigonometry identity;

Sin(D+E) = SinDcosE + CosDSinE

Sin(D-E) = SinDcosE - CosDSinE

Applying this in the expression above;

4{Sin(A+B)CosA - Cos(A+B)SinA} = 3{Sin(A+B)CosA + Cos(A+B)sinA}

Open the bracket

4Sin(A+B)CosA - 4Cos(A+B)SinA = 3Sin(A+B)CosA + 3Cos(A+B)sinA

Collecting like terms

4Sin(A+B)CosA - 3Sin(A+B)cosA = 3Cos(A+B)sinA + 4Cos(A+B)sinA

Sin(A+B)CosA = 7Cos(A+B)sinA

Divide both sides by sinA

Sin(A+B)CosA/sinA= 7Cos(A+B)sinA/sinA

Since cosA/sinA = cotA, the expression becomes;

Sin(A+B)cotA = 7Cos(A+B)

Finally, divide both sides of the resulting equation by sin(A+B)

Sin(A+B)cotA/sin(A+B) = 7Cos(A+B)/sin(A+B)

CotA = 7cot(A+B) Proved!

Simplify the given expression below: (−3 + 2i) ⋅ (2 + i) A. −8 + i B. −6 + 3i C. −3 + 4i D. −1 + 2i
oksian1 [2.3K]

Answer:

-8 + i

Step-by-step explanation:

(-3 + 2i) * (2 + i)

= -6 + -3i + 4i + 2i^2

= -6 + i - 2

= -8 + i
